Biological Background: HOMER1 Function and Localization

  • HOMER1 is a postsynaptic density scaffolding protein that belongs to the Homer family, encoded by the HOMER1 gene (Gene ID: 9456) and also known as SYN47.
  • It binds and cross-links cytoplasmic regions of metabotropic glutamate receptors (GRM1, GRM5), inositol 1,4,5-trisphosphate receptor (ITPR1), ryanodine receptors (RYR1, RYR2), and scaffold proteins (SHANK1, SHANK3), coupling surface receptors to intracellular calcium release.
  • Isoform 1 (canonical) regulates trafficking and surface expression of GRM5, while isoform 3 acts as a dominant negative, competing with isoform 1 to modulate synaptic metabotropic glutamate signaling, thereby influencing long-term neuronal plasticity and development.
  • HOMER1 forms high-order complexes with SHANK1, essential for the structural and functional integrity of dendritic spines (By similarity).
  • It negatively regulates T cell activation by inhibiting the calcineurin-NFAT pathway, acting as a competitive inhibitor of NFAT binding by calcineurin/PPP3CA. Related references: PMID:18218901
  • Subcellularly, HOMER1 localizes to the cytoplasm, postsynaptic density, synapse, and dendritic spines.
  • Post-translational modifications include acetylation and phosphorylation, and the protein features alternative splicing and a coiled coil domain.

Experimental Guidance and Technical Tips

  • The immunogen corresponds to a central region of HOMER1 (aa 125-354) and is expected to recognize all isoforms sharing this sequence; confirm isoform specificity if needed.
  • For Western blot, a band around 40kDa is anticipated; validate in your sample system to account for tissue-specific expression and potential isoforms.
  • In immunofluorescence (IF-P), consider co-staining with synaptic markers to confirm dendritic spine localization.
  • For ELISA, optimize coating antigen and detection conditions using the purified recombinant protein if available.
